Output bd5a6593ade872b411799572eab3d417f7bc14bd8edf9bb06f9928805fc31620:1

value
34643267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5c939a736d482b2bd9dfa47a80b521bbbce756 OP_EQUAL
address
3JryrwY8H1xUrah3fPrboHvsZUGQ8Cvto7
transaction
bd5a6593ade872b411799572eab3d417f7bc14bd8edf9bb06f9928805fc31620
confirmations
207904
spent
true